The best parts of Camping gear

from: David C Skul




Group or family camping is a great way to build closer
relationships between individuals. If you are a beginner, the
best way is to start with tent camping, as the camping gear
required can be purchased at a reasonable price. Tent camping
includes car camping, canoe camping and backpacking. The camping
gear required for such activities should only consist of
strictly necessary items such as camping tents, sleeping bags,
stoves, lanterns, maps, etc.



You can car camp at state and national parks, forest service
campsites, and even national chains of commercial campgrounds,
some of them even provide a part of the camping gear you need.
There are lots of places to go and stay.



Tent camping is popular, and this is how most people start out.
Some people love tent camping so much they never do any other
type of camping. Others become RV´ers, invest in a different
kind of camping gear and try out a pop-up tent trailer, then a
camping trailer or a motor home as well as the required camping
gear for these vehicles. Even so, most of them still keep a
tent, some sleeping bags, and some kind of different camping
gear, handy for their younger guests.



Wherever you decide to go camping, make sure you get enjoyable
and safe outdoor experiences while camping, hiking, wildlife
watching, fishing and hunting and whatever the brand you choose
for your camping gear, you should make sure it keeps you warm,
dry and comfortable in all weather conditions - sun, wind, rain
or snow!



Your tent will be your biggest purchase. It is also the most
important part of the camping gear you need to make your trip a
successful one. Your camping gear should include a few sleeping
bags, as they are very important for getting a good night's
sleep.



All sleeping bags need an isolating pad underneath for proper
warmth and comfort, so you shouldn't exclude this from your
camping gear. A camp lantern makes late night suppers easy, and
lets you play games or read after sunset, so include one in your
camping gear.
